Output 24f541d6502ef377640fde8ab7fc0b24493e73c1ff7c531a75f0d88ba892e269:0

value
129867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90850ea12420ad7d20dfa841d0d83d9aab16a112 OP_EQUAL
address
3EsAd94znrQiY1hVdqyqZyXkykt4BMXVuy
transaction
24f541d6502ef377640fde8ab7fc0b24493e73c1ff7c531a75f0d88ba892e269
spent
true